Photovoltaics and other renewable technologies
Nowadays, with an increasing emphasis on ecology and sustainability, photovoltaics in construction and other renewable technologies are gaining popularity. Harnessing the sun’s energy through photovoltaic panels or solar collectors is not only a step toward environmental protection, but also a way to significantly reduce the cost of operating a home.
Photovoltaic panels, installed on rooftops or other suitable locations, convert sunlight into electricity, allowing for energy self-sufficiency or a significant reduction in electricity bills. A home heat pump is another solution that draws energy from the environment (e.g., the ground or air) to heat or cool rooms, which also helps reduce the use of traditional energy sources.

Innovative building materials
In today’s world, single-family construction is increasingly using innovative building materials that not only contribute to energy efficiency, but also contribute to the aesthetics and durability of the structure. Among them are frame technologies in construction, which allow for faster and more flexible building structures.
One of the most interesting solutions is environmentally friendly concrete This is a material that uses recycled components in its composition, which significantly reduces its negative impact on the environment. Concrete of this type is not only durable, but also effectively insulates thermally, which translates into lower costs for heating and cooling rooms.
Another innovation is bricks with a cooling system This is a modern solution that allows passive cooling of interiors, thanks to the special design of the bricks. They are capable of absorbing excess heat during the day and giving it back at night, which maintains a pleasant temperature in the house without the need for energy-consuming air conditioning units.

The future of construction: 3D printer homes and CLT technologies
The vision of the future of construction is painted in extremely innovative colors, where 3D printer houses and Cross-Laminated Timber (CLT) technologies play a key role. These cutting-edge approaches are not only revolutionizing the way we build, but also offer a number of advantages that could change our perception of housing.
Three-dimensional printing in construction allows structures to be erected quickly, which is particularly beneficial in situations that require an immediate response, such as after natural disasters. 3D-printed homes can also be designed with a high degree of precision, which minimizes material waste and allows for the creation of more complex architectural shapes. This is modern construction in its purest form, which is becoming increasingly accessible thanks to advances in technology.
In contrast, CLT technology is revolutionizing the use of wood in construction. Cross-laminated wood panels are not only durable, but also offer excellent thermal and acoustic insulation. CLT technologies in construction make it possible to build faster and greener, making it ideal for a future that requires us to be more environmentally responsible.
